Francisco Cerúndolo’s 2024 French Open Match Used Pro Stock Head PT57A Racket – Used vs. Novak Djokovic in Epic 5-Set Fourth Round
Offered here is a match-used pro stock racket from Francisco Cerúndolo’s 2024 French Open campaign, used during his June 3rd, 2024 fourth-round showdown against Novak Djokovic — one of the most gripping matches of the tournament.
Cerúndolo pushed the 23-time Grand Slam champion to the brink, taking a two-sets-to-one lead before falling in five sets in a dramatic Court Philippe-Chatrier battle. This very racket was used by Cerúndolo during that unforgettable encounter.
The racket is a Head PT57A pro stock frame.
